Sitterly Wins the 2014 Oswego Classic

Despite an extra distance of 209 laps and a rain delayed start in Oswego Speedway’s 58th annual Budweiser International Classic 200 on Sunday, which saw two late race green-white-checkered attempts, Canajoharie, NY pilot Otto Sitterly once again reigned supreme in the Classic as he drove away from the 34 car field for his fourth career International Classic triumph worth well over $18,000. RJ Johnson Sails to Tularosa Win

RJ Johnson won the USAC Southwest Sprint Car feature at Tularosa Speedway Sunday night. Johnson was chased by Charles Davis Jr.,Josh Pelkey, Matt Rossi and Tye Mihocko.

Hickle scores first ASCS Frontier win at Great Falls

For the second straight night, someone from outside the state of Montana picked up his first career victory in Big Sky Country, as Quilcene, Wash.’s J.J. Hickle led all 25 laps to win the ASCS Frontier Region sprint car main event in the final night of the 20th Annual Montana Round-Up at Electric City Speedway on Sunday. […]

Logan Forler Wires ASCS Southwest Field at Tucson

Finishing runner up at the Tucson International Raceway on Saturday, Logan Forler saw to it that all challengers were held off on Sunday night as the Steve Forler Trucking No. 2L led start-to-finish for Forler’s fourth career ASCS Southwest Region victory. […]
